PopCap Games May Go Public
In an interview with Forbes' Oliver Chiang, PopCap Games CEO Dave Roberts confirmed that his company is gearing up for a possible initial public offering in the second half of 2011.
According to the Forbes report, "PopCap just took its first-ever round of funding, $22.5 million, last year in October," money which was used to capitalize on opportunities and fuel expansion.
Going public in 2011 could help the company expand exponentially faster, but apparently there isn't a lot of urgency to do so from the company's current ensemble of private investors.
“We’ll look at [an IPO] for the second half of next year,” Roberts told Forbes. Adding, “There are no investors pushing for it, so we will really only look at it if the markets align.”
